Share Repurchase
A company's decision to buy back its own shares from the marketplace, reducing the number of outstanding shares.
Capital Gains
The increase in value of an asset or investment over time, realized upon the sale of that asset.
Residual Dividend Policy
A strategy where dividends paid to shareholders are set as the remaining profits after all project financing and working capital needs are met.
Capital Budget
The process and plan for determining and allocating resources, such as funds and investments, towards major long-term expenditures or projects of a company or government.
